D103159 - Oracle Linux System Administration III

The Oracle Linux System Administration III course covers the implementation of advanced Linux file systems, configuring virtualization services and resource management controls, use of Docker containers and Kubernetes container orchestration services, advanced security services, and advanced diagnostics services. The course also provides extensive hands-on experience for advanced system administration tasks.

Learn to:

  • Address today's large storage requirements including the Oracle Cluster File System, iSCSI and multipathing, and use of the Gluster File System.
  • Manage resources to deliver consistent response times and performance.
  • Allocate system resources to specific Linux processes.
  • Use DTrace, which provides a comprehensive look into the software stack and enables you to identify performance bottlenecks.
  • Use container technologies, including Oracle Container Runtime for Docker and Oracle Linux Container Services for use with Kubernetes.
  • Use the Linux Auditing System and OpenSCAP to enhance system security.

Gain Hands-On Experience:

Extensive hands-on practices will guide you through each concept. You will install different types of file systems, including OCFS2 and Gluster. You will also experience how to share storage devices across multiple systems, allocate system resources such as CPU, memory, network and I/O bandwidth to critical processes. You will also learn container technology by installing and configuring Oracle Container Runtime for Docker and Oracle Linux Container Services for use with Kubernetes.

Objectives

  • Configure Oracle Cluster File System version 2 (OCFS2)
  • Configure iSCSI targets and initiators
  • Configure control groups (Cgroups)
  • Configure Kernel-based Virtual Machine (KVM)
  • Work with Docker containers and perform container orchestration by using Kubernetes
  • Secure your system by using SELinux, OpenSCAP, OpenSSL, and Linux Auditing
  • Install and view Linux kernel source code and describe other Linux internal topics
  • Enable core dump and perform core dump analysis
  • Configure dynamic tracing (DTrace)
  • Configure the Gluster File System

Content

  • OCFS2 and Oracle Clusterware
  • iSCSI and Multipathing
  • Managing Resources with Control Groups (cgroups)
  • Virtualization with Linux
  • Oracle Container Runtime for Docker
  • Oracle Linux Container Services for Use with Kubernetes
  • Security Enhanced Linux (SELinux)
  • OpenSCAP
  • OpenSSL
  • Introduction to Linux Internals
  • Linux Auditing System
  • Core Dump Analysis
  • Dynamic Tracking with DTrace
  • Using Gluster Storage
